Pakistan Life Savers Programme (PLSP is based on partnerships between academia, health sector, and government and aims to train 10 million Pakistani citizens in CPR and bleeding control over the next 10 years.

The findings from our Equi-injury: NIHR Global Health Group on equitable access to quality health care for injured people in four low- or middle-income countries study are now out.

This work focused on improving equitable access to quality injury care in developing settings by identifying system gaps and co-developing solutions with local communities. Conducted across four trauma centers in Sindh, Pakistan, two rural and two urban, the study enrolled 2,929 patients to map real-world care pathways and barriers.

What is an AED? An Automated External Defibrillator is a portable device that uses pads placed on the chest to analyze the heart’s electrical rhythm and, if it detects a dangerous rhythm like ventricular fibrillation or pulseless ventricular tachycardia, delivers a controlled shock to help restore a normal heartbeat.

You do not need to be a doctor, the AED guides you step by step so you can act confidently in an emergency and potentially save a life.
